OHAKUNE SAWMILLS.
A FORTNIGHT'S HOLIDAY. ("BY TELEGRAPH. —PRESS ASSOCIATION, j OHAKUNE, Tuesday. In view of the present unsettled condition of the sawmilling industry, most of the sawmills in the Ohakune district will close for a fortnight at Easter instead of for the customary four days.
